Story from the middle east is that the 20 aircraft order is for Qatar, a mix of LR/ER's. VS would be VERY lucky to secure a B777 delivery before late 2008, it is proving very popular (perhaps due to increased reliability & efficiency compared to the A346). Air France, Emirates, Etihad, Cathay Pacific plus numerous others have substantial orders in for the B777 & i can't see anybody giving up delivery slots!!!!!
More to the point as launch customer VS got a very good price for the A346. If you recall the market place was in turmoil after 9/11 & VS used this to their full advantage when doing a deal. The B777 at the time wasn't as efficient as the current GE90-115 powered ER & -110 powered LR.
